We quash the writ of assistance and the certificate of title which we recalled by earlier order. The writ of assistance and certificate of title cannot issue until after the trial court has resolved the petitioner's pending objection to the foreclosure sale. See Caplan v. Neumann, 699 So.2d 1052 (Fla. 4th DCA 1997);Nelson v. Santora, 570 So.2d 1374 (Fla. 1st DCA 1990).
